Wenger surprised by Forest signing Bendtner

He failed to see the best of Nicklas Bendtner during nine years at Arsenal, and Arsene Wenger will come up against the Dane on Tuesday. Ahead of Arsenal's EFL Cup tie with Nottingham Forest, Arsene Wenger says he was surprised to see Nicklas Bendtner sign a two-year deal at the City Ground. Bendtner spent nine years at Arsenal, making 171 appearances without ever doing enough to fulfil his self-proclaimed wish to be the best striker in the world. Released in 2014, Bendtner had a brief spell in the Bundesliga with Wolfsburg, before arriving at Forest earlier this month.
